Output 2295ae4dac03a276dd69027a30858050f691249f87d9d40c74e8458a1685a040:25

value
1370000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81d4c995d98cfdc2b0cd76891f7b573cf11cfef1 OP_EQUAL
address
3DXW129Y9Q5YKbr6p5D9HXrPwfJ6VLUddj
transaction
2295ae4dac03a276dd69027a30858050f691249f87d9d40c74e8458a1685a040
spent
true